Woolrich, Pa. – October 19, 2009 –Woolrich, Inc., the Original Outdoor Clothing Company®, has partnered with Dorfman Pacific to launch a new line of outdoor lifestyle headwear. Dorfman Pacific will source, manufacture, sell and distribute Woolrich branded men’s and women’s headwear collections to department stores, specialty stores and catalogs throughout the United States and Canada.

Nick Brayton, Licensing Manager for Accessories at Woolrich stated “having a brand like Woolrich partner with Dorfman Pacific, the largest headwear company in the world, sets the stage for a terrific headwear line and a tremendous amount of success.”

“We are thrilled to become a licensee of the Woolrich brand and see enormous potential in this agreement,” said Doug Highsmith, President and CEO, Dorfman Pacific. “Woolrich has a history of quality and value and we look forward to offering outdoor lifestyle products that support the brand message .”

The headwear collection will be available in stores for Fall 2010, ranging from knits, cloth and wool felt in men’s and women’s styles complementing the Woolrich sportswear and outerwear collections. The fall headwear line will be shown at several National Trade shows starting January 2010 as well as Dorfman Pacific showrooms located in New York, Boston, Denver, Dallas, Atlanta and its corporate headquarters in Stockton, CA.

About Dorfman Pacific®

Dorfman Pacific, founded in 1921, prides itself in being the largest full-line in-stock headwear company in the world with offices throughout the USA and attendance at all major trade shows. The company continues to pursue growth both through licensing opportunities such as Woolrich, and through the acquisition of businesses that naturally complement its existing activities. Dorfman Pacific, acquired Capelli Straworld in May 2009 – one of the country’s premier resort handbag manufacturers. Operating from its 275,000 square foot corporate headquarters and distribution center facility in Stockton, it has showrooms throughout the USA, and customers worldwide for its men’s, women’s and children’s headwear, bags and accessories. Dorfman Pacific brands include Scala, Stacy Adams, Indiana Jones, Callanan, Christys’ of London, Christys’ Crown Series, Tropical Trends, Blue Chair Bay™ by Kenny Chesney, DPC Global Trends and Outdoors, Headers, Scala Pro Golf and Panama Jack. Its Milano division features Larry Mahan and Justin Authentic Headwear.

About Woolrich®

Woolrich Inc., the Original Outdoor Clothing Company, is an authentic American brand that embraces an outdoor lifestyle. Trusted since 1830 by generations of loyal consumers, Woolrich continues its tradition of providing quality products for today’s outdoor enthusiast. A brand recognized worldwide, Woolrich product offerings include functional, comfortable and durable men’s and women’s sportswear and outerwear using innovative fabrications for the ultimate in performance capabilities, well-designed home and outdoor living products, and licensed accessory products. In 2005, Woolrich celebrated its 175th Anniversary. It is the original and longest continuously-operating outdoor apparel manufacturer and woolen mill in the United States.
